American, mixed-race and fiercely independent, Meghan Markle, Prince Harry’s actor girlfriend, will breathe fresh air into the British royal family when she marries Queen Elizabeth II’s grandson next spring.

Playing a lawyer in the hit television show Suits, the 36-year-old actress with long flowing black hair was barely known in Britain when her name appeared on newspaper front pages last October. The tabloids based their report of a relationship between Harry and Markle, who lived in Toronto, Canada, on pictures showing them wearing the same tricoloured wristband.
